Floral Energy Gatherers: Capturing Solar Energy

Plants possess a remarkable ability to harness the sun's energy. Through photosynthesis, they convert light into chemical energy, fueling their growth and development. This process begins in chloroplasts, tiny organelles found within plant cells. These organelles contain chlorophyll, a pigment that absorbs sunlight, particularly in the red and blue wavelengths.

The absorbed light energy drives a series of complex chemical reactions. Water molecules are split, releasing oxygen as a byproduct. The electrons released from water are then used to convert carbon dioxide into glucose, a simple sugar that serves as the plant's primary source of energy. This process not only sustains the plant but also contributes the global ecosystem by producing oxygen and absorbing carbon dioxide from the atmosphere.

Photosynthesis in Full Bloom

As the sun beams down upon the vibrant garden, a miraculous process transpires - photosynthesis. Plants, like master alchemists, harness the energy of sunlight to convert simple ingredients into the essential materials of life. Within each leaf, a symphony of processes occurs, powered by light and air, resulting in the synthesis read more of sugars that nourish the plant's growth.

  • Chlorophyll, the pigment that gives plants their verdant hue, acts as the solar panel, capturing sunlight and initiating the chain reaction.
  • Water, absorbed from the soil through the roots, makes its way to the leaves, where it combines with carbon dioxide taken up from the air.
  • This astonishing fusion of elements, orchestrated by sunlight, produces glucose, a simple sugar that serves as the plant's primary fuel.

Moreover, photosynthesis has a profound impact on our planet. It produces oxygen into the atmosphere, which is essential for animal life, and captures carbon dioxide from the air, helping to counteract the effects of climate change.
